Overview of role:

We are seeking a highly motivated and experienced Quantity Surveyor with a background in Construction and/or energy projects to join our team. The Quantity Surveyor will be responsible for the preparation of tender and contract documents, cost plans, evaluation of tenders, negotiations with contractors, cost monitoring and expenditure.

Key Responsibilities:

* Prepare tender and contract documents, including bills of quantities
* Prepare cost plans to enable design teams to produce practical designs for construction projects, which involves liaising with engineers and subcontractors.
* Evaluate tenders from contractors and subcontractors and, where appropriate, negotiate with the contractors.
* Control all stages of projects within predetermined budget, a Cost Monitoring and expenditure.
* Monitor and keep track of project progress and are responsible for the measurement and valuation of variations in the work during the contract, for agreement of interim payments and the final account.
* Collaborate with clients, engineers, sub-contractors, and suppliers.
* Preparation of accurate forecasts of project costs to completion and final value.
* On site valuations and progress reports
* Monthly cost/value reports and management accounts
* Work as part of a team to ensure that the requirements of the client are delivered.
